Understanding Breakout Trading
Breakout trading focuses on identifying key price levels where the market is likely to make a significant move. Traders enter positions once the price breaks above resistance or below support, aiming to capture the momentum that follows. Key MT5 Indicators for Breakout Trading
Several MT5 Indicators are particularly useful for breakout trading:
- Bollinger Bands: Highlight volatility and potential breakout zones by showing price compression areas.
- ATR (Average True Range): Measures market volatility to determine stop-loss placement and position sizing.
- Moving Averages: Identify trend direction post-breakout and provide dynamic support and resistance levels.
- MACD (Moving Average Convergence Divergence): Confirms momentum following a breakout.
- Volume Indicators: Higher volume often validates breakout strength, supporting trade decisions.

Combining Indicators for Breakout Confirmation
Relying on a single indicator can result in false signals, particularly in choppy or low-volatility markets. Combining multiple indicators improves the accuracy of breakout identification. For example, a trader may use Bollinger Bands to spot price compression, ATR to assess volatility, and MACD to confirm momentum after the breakout.

Risk Management in Breakout Trading
Breakouts can sometimes fail, leading to reversals and potential losses. MT5 Indicators help traders set precise stop-loss levels, take-profit targets, and position sizing. ATR can guide volatility-based stop-loss placement, while moving averages and Bollinger Bands provide additional confirmation for exits or scaling positions.
